Tip #2: Add a Drizzle of Olive Oil After Cooking

Olive oil, especially extra-virgin olive oil, is known for its health benefits, primarily thanks to its high content of heart-healthy monounsaturated fats and antioxidative compounds. However, when olive oil is exposed to high temperatures during cooking, there is a potential that some of these beneficial compounds will start to degrade.

One of Giada’s top tips for making your favorite pasta dish healthier is adding your drizzle of extra virgin olive oil after cooking. This helps preserve all of those good-for-you nutrients to maximize the oil’s health benefits and add a delicious burst of flavor. Tip #3: Add Extra Veggies

To make pasta night healthy, one of Giada’s simple but genius tips is to pack in extra veggies. A simple way to do this is to blend them into your tomato sauce. Carrots are a particularly good option as they add a deliciously sweet flavor to your sauce. You can also easily add extra vegetables to a bolognese, like this vegetable bolognese dish, and pair versatile vegetables like zucchini, eggplant, mushrooms, and artichokes. 

Tip #4: Eat The Way Italians Do 

When serving up your pasta dish, Giada’s tip is to practice portion control the way Italians do. Serve yourself a small portion of pasta alongside a protein dish, rather than consuming just a big bowl of pasta. By adding protein to your pasta meal, you’ll help support satiety, as protein is the most filling macronutrient, making it less likely that you’ll overeat. This helps keep your pasta serving size in check!
